Cost

The price of a wood burning stove can vary depending on the size, age, and the quality. In general, you will pay more for a new stove than an older one. It is essential to know this prior to deciding to purchase a stove on the internet. It is also important to factor in the installation costs and other extras that might be required by the stove you are considering.

Stoves can be a great benefit to any home, providing warmth and ambience. They are great for winter when temperatures fall below freezing. On the market are many different types of stoves, from traditional models to modern ones. They can be used with various fuels, including wood and multi-fuel.

A second-hand model can save you money over the cost of a brand new model. However, it is important to be aware of certain issues when purchasing a second-hand stove. Asking the seller a lot of questions about the stove before purchasing it. This will ensure that you get the best price and the stove is in good working condition.

You should be able get answers to the majority of your questions, but it is still recommended to ask questions before you make an important decision. You can, for instance inquire with the seller about the material the stove is constructed from, if it has carbon monoxide detectors and what the age is. In addition, you must check if the seller has spare parts for the stove in case something goes wrong with it.

Some sellers are not upfront about the condition their stove. Only consider a used stove that is in good condition. You should also examine the stove prior to purchasing it.

Efficiency

Cooking in the wilderness is easy with efficient stoves. They burn any liquid fuel, and boil water in the most demanding conditions. They are versatile, they can be employed in any climate and are suitable for almost every type of excursion. However, they do have their fair share of problems. It is important to read reviews before purchasing an used multi-fuel stove, and to understand how to use the stove properly. You could end up with an old stove that isn't big enough or that splutters. These problems are often the result of user error. If you research the issue, you can avoid them.

When buying an old stove, the first thing to be looking at is its efficiency. Modern stoves typically have efficiency ratings of 80% or higher. If a stove is less than this level will need more fuel to produce the same amount of heat.

The efficiency of a stove may be diminished by general wear and tear, faulty seals, or a lack of maintenance. Additionally, certain brands of fuel may not be compatible with your particular stove. It is recommended to stay clear of the flammable fuels like bituminous coal and manufactured smokeless fuel and avoid anthracite, which can be difficult to ignite.
